The bamboo-based composite pipes produced by China Railway Construction are manufactured through automated processes; as a new type of bio-based material pipe, they feature low weight, high tensile strength, corrosion resistance, and a long service life. As a low-carbon and environmentally friendly product, with an annual production capacity of 1.2 million tons, it can help reduce carbon dioxide emissions by around 6 million tons, and sequester or fix about 10 million tons of carbon. It plays a significant role in achieving the goals of carbon peak and carbon neutrality, and has been **included in the list of key products for replacing plastic with bamboo**
There are mainly three factors that restrict the development of this industry: First, the product portfolio of bamboo-based composite materials is relatively limited, with insufficient expansion of both vertical and horizontal industrial chains, and regional industrial clusters have not yet been truly established. Secondly, there is a lack of technological development; it is necessary to focus efforts on overcoming key technologies in order to address the issues of a small and fragmented industry scale, as well as low levels of continuity, automation, and intelligence. Third, the development of standards and certification systems for bamboo-based composites is relatively lagging behind; their application scenarios are limited, and market acceptance remains low. Solving these problems requires strong support from the government as well as efforts from businesses.
